Will a digi 002 control a HD2 system?
Will a digi 002 console control a HD2 system and still be able to track with the inputs/ADAT?
I'm looking to slowly upgrade to a HD2 setup starting with the PCI cards to free up CPU usage, then add the 192i/o etc since I don't have all the $ to get the whole deal. My main issue right now is maxing out CPU usage due to number of plugins, and I don't want to keep bouncing down back and forth every time I decide I need to change something. Re: Will a digi 002 control a HD2 system?
The short answer is no.
A Command8 or C|24 will work with both LE and HD. Possibly a Pro Control Your going to need the HD cards and the HD interface to get HD working. To the best of my knowlage the 002 is not going to provide any funtionality. Your probably better of trading it in or selling it outright.

Re: Will a digi 002 control a HD2 system?
There's no halfway point between hd and le. You need to buy an HD core and an HD interface to use HD. LE interfaces only work with LE software, HD interfaces only work with HD software.
